⚫Match the anesthesia term to it's definition:
a. general
b. regional
c. monitored anesthesia care (MAC)
d. moderate sedation
e. local
1. administration of anesthetic agents by an anesthesiologist, CRNA, or
specially trained perioperative RN
2. an injection of local anesthetics near nerve fibers to cause reversible
loss of sensation over an area of the body
3. anesthesia provider monitory and sedation of the pt
4. drug induced, reversible state of unconsciousness
5. infiltration or topical administration of agents to anesthetize a body part.
Answer: a. 4, b. 2, c. 3, d. 1, e. 5
⚫The endotracheal tube or laryngeal mask airway is removed
a. when the pt is able to maintain their airway
b. when the pt is fully awake
c. after in IV injection of sugammadex
d. one the narcotic reversal agent is administered. Answer: a
⚫The most consistent early indicator of a malignant hyperthermia crisis is
a. a change in the ECG
b. an increase in end tidal CO2
c. hyperkalemia
d. lactic acidosis. Answer: b
⚫When is it appropriate for the periop nurse to release cricoid pressure?
a. as the anesthesia provider starts to intubate the pt
b. one the trachea is occluded
c. when the ET tube cuff is inflated
d. when the ET tube stylet is removed. Answer: c

⚫perioperative nursing care documentation must include a description of
the pt care delivered and the pt response to that care
a. True
b. False. Answer: A
⚫What is the perioperative RN's responsibility regarding informed
consent?
a. Ensure that the consent is correct, signed and witnessed
b. Obtain verbal consent if there is no written consent
c. Provide the pt a list of alternative treatments to the proposed surgery
d. Review the procedure and expected outcome with the pt. Answer: A
⚫The pat's privacy is guaranteed under the HIPPA. What other resource
should the nurse review before sharing a pt's healthcare information?
a. The facility's policy and procedure
b. Department protocol
c. Physician's notes
d. None of the above. Answer: A
⚫Which of the following must be noted during the preoperative nurse's
assessment?
a. Financial and insurance info
b. Length of illness and physical therapy arrangements
c. Detailed religious beliefs and expectations of the surgical outcome
d. Family of personal reactions to anesthesia. Answer: D
